Créateur de Diagramme ER IA — FreeDiagram
Décrivez votre schéma de base de données en langage naturel et FreeDiagram génère instantanément le diagramme entité-relation avec entités, attributs et relations. Gratuit, illimité, sans inscription.
Free forever · no signup · no credit card · unlimited diagrams
Un diagramme entité-relation (ER) cartographie la structure d'une base de données en montrant ses entités (tables), leurs attributs (colonnes) et les relations entre elles. Que vous conceviez un nouveau schéma ou documentiez une base existante, un diagramme ER clair est le moyen le plus rapide d'aligner votre équipe et de repérer les relations manquantes avant d'écrire une ligne de SQL. FreeDiagram lit votre description en français et produit un diagramme ER structuré en quelques secondes — sans abonnement à un outil de diagramme.
Comment créer un diagramme ER en quelques secondes
Décrivez votre modèle de données
Listez les entités principales (tables) et mentionnez les relations clés — par exemple : « les utilisateurs ont plusieurs commandes, chaque commande a plusieurs lignes, les commandes appartiennent à des clients ».
FreeDiagram dessine le schéma
L'IA identifie les entités, attributs et cardinalités, puis génère un diagramme ER propre avec la notation crow's-foot — clés primaires, clés étrangères et lignes de relation incluses.
Révisez et affinez
Ajoutez des tables manquantes, ajustez les relations ou précisez la cardinalité en modifiant votre description et en régénérant instantanément — chaque exécution est gratuite et ne prend que quelques secondes.
Exportez en SVG ou PNG
Téléchargez un vecteur SVG net sans filigrane ou un PNG haute résolution pour la documentation, les présentations ou le partage avec votre équipe technique.
Qu'est-ce qu'un diagramme ER et quand l'utiliser ?
Un diagramme entité-relation (ER) est un plan visuel d'une base de données relationnelle. Introduit par Peter Chen en 1976, il est devenu l'outil standard de conception de bases de données en génie logiciel, architecture de données et informatique universitaire.
Dans un diagramme ER, les entités représentent des tables, les attributs des colonnes, et les lignes de relation montrent comment les tables se connectent. Les équipes modernes utilisent généralement la notation crow's-foot (IE) : les entités sont des boîtes listant leurs champs, les clés primaires sont marquées PK, et les lignes de relation portent des marqueurs de cardinalité — un-à-un (1:1), un-à-plusieurs (1:N) ou plusieurs-à-plusieurs (M:N).
Les diagrammes ER sont utiles à chaque étape du développement. Lors de la conception, ils aident les équipes à s'accorder sur le modèle de données avant d'écrire les migrations. Pendant la revue de code, ils rendent les changements de schéma immédiatement visibles pour les non-spécialistes. Lors de l'intégration, ils permettent aux nouveaux membres de comprendre l'architecture des données en un coup d'œil sans lire du SQL brut.
La génération par IA change considérablement le flux de travail. Au lieu de faire glisser des boîtes d'entités et de tracer des lignes de relation, vous décrivez le domaine en langage naturel — « une application SaaS avec utilisateurs, équipes, abonnements et factures » — et le diagramme apparaît instantanément. C'est particulièrement utile pour le prototypage rapide, les revues avec les parties prenantes et les discussions d'architecture en phase précoce où la vitesse prime sur la précision parfaite.
FreeDiagram prend en charge des diagrammes ER de toute complexité, des schémas simples à trois tables aux modèles multi-domaines d'entreprise. Générez une première ébauche fonctionnelle en secondes, puis affinez de façon itérative en ajustant votre description et en régénérant.
Frequently asked questions
Le créateur de diagramme ER est-il gratuit ?
Oui — complètement gratuit, générations illimitées, sans inscription ni carte de crédit. Le site est financé par la publicité.
Quelle notation le diagramme ER utilise-t-il ?
FreeDiagram utilise la notation crow's-foot (IE) par défaut — le style le plus courant dans les équipes logicielles modernes. Les entités sont des boîtes et les lignes de relation portent des marqueurs de cardinalité montrant les relations un-à-plusieurs ou plusieurs-à-plusieurs.
Puis-je exporter le diagramme pour la documentation ?
Oui. Téléchargez en SVG pour des graphiques vectoriels nets qui s'adaptent à n'importe quelle taille, ou en PNG pour des images matricielles. Les deux formats sont sans filigrane et gratuits.
À quel point ma description doit-elle être spécifique ?
Énumérer les tables principales et leurs relations clés donne les meilleurs résultats. Mentionner les clés primaires, les clés étrangères ou la cardinalité (un-à-plusieurs, plusieurs-à-plusieurs) produit un diagramme plus complet et précis.
FreeDiagram peut-il gérer les relations plusieurs-à-plusieurs ?
Oui. Décrivez la relation naturellement — « les étudiants s'inscrivent à plusieurs cours, et chaque cours a plusieurs étudiants » — et FreeDiagram la modélisera correctement, en ajoutant souvent une table de jonction automatiquement.